What Does It Really Mean to Be an Entrepreneur?

Entrepreneurship is more than just creating businesses; it s a mindset, a way of seeing opportunities where others see problems. Essentially, being an entrepreneur means identifying needs or demands in the market and creating innovative solutions to address them. This process involves ideating, developing products or services, and implementing strategies to reach the target audience.

Entrepreneurship is the act of creating, developing, and managing a new business, typically with the goal of making a profit, but it can also include social or environmental causes. Entrepreneurs are individuals who take risks, face uncertainties, and work with determination to turn their ideas into reality.
There are several types of entrepreneurship, including:
- Business Entrepreneurship: Focused on creating profitable companies, often starting with startups.
- Social Entrepreneurship: Aims to solve social or environmental problems, often without profit as the main motivation.
- Digital Entrepreneurship: Uses the internet as the primary platform for business, such as e-commerce and digital products.
- Corporate Entrepreneurship: Occurs within large companies, where employees create new products or services.
What Are the Challenges of Entrepreneurship?
Although entrepreneurship is often glorified as a path to financial and personal freedom, it comes with a series of challenges that entrepreneurs must face.
- Uncertainty and Financial Risk: One of the biggest challenges is uncertainty. Many entrepreneurs invest their savings or take out loans to fund their businesses, which can be risky. Financial returns may take time, and failure is a real possibility.
- Lack of Experience and Knowledge: Beginner entrepreneurs often face a steep learning curve. From financial management to marketing and sales, there’s a lot to learn. A lack of knowledge in essential areas can hinder business growth.
- Competition and Market Pressure: Competition is fierce in many sectors. Staying competitive requires constant innovation, which can be exhausting and demand significant resources.
- Work-Life Balance: Entrepreneurship can consume a lot of time and energy, leading to challenges in balancing work and personal life. Many entrepreneurs risk burnout due to long hours and constant stress.
- Bureaucracy and Regulations: Navigating the legal and regulatory environment can be complex. From registrations and licenses to taxes and compliance, there are many legal issues that can challenge new entrepreneurs.
- Raising Capital: Securing funds to start or grow a business can be one of the hardest tasks. Access to financing, investors, or even crowdfunding requires not just a good business plan but also negotiation skills and a network of contacts.
- Team Management: Entrepreneurs need to be strong leaders to attract and retain talent. Building a committed team aligned with the company values is crucial, but it can be challenging, especially in a competitive job market.
How to Overcome the Challenges?
Despite the challenges, many entrepreneurs find success by adopting a resilient mindset and constantly seeking to learn. Careful planning, market research, and seeking mentors or support networks can make the difference between success and failure. Additionally, developing skills like adaptability, creativity, and communication can help navigate the obstacles.
Entrepreneurship is a journey that demands courage, persistence, and passion. For those willing to face the challenges, the potential for personal and professional growth is limitless.
